In addition to the aesthetic and health benefits, windows also play a practical role in maintaining a comfortable indoor environment. Properly insulated windows can help regulate the temperature inside the home, keeping it cool in the summer and warm in the winter. This can lead to energy savings by reducing the need for heating and cooling appliances, ultimately lowering utility bills.
Furthermore, windows can help improve ventilation in a home, allowing for fresh air to circulate and remove indoor pollutants. This is especially important for maintaining good indoor air quality, which can have a significant impact on the health and wellbeing of the residents. Opening windows regularly can help reduce the buildup of allergens, mold, and other harmful substances, creating a healthier living environment.

In terms of materials, options range from wood, vinyl, aluminum, and fiberglass, each with its own set of advantages and considerations. Wood windows offer a classic and natural look, while vinyl windows are low-maintenance and energy-efficient. Aluminum windows are durable and strong, while fiberglass windows are known for their strength and durability.
